  • Legal Counsel, Privacy will own how TRM keeps Orion compliant with privacy and data-protection laws around the world, partnering directly with Product, Engineering, and GTM so the company can expand into new markets without slowing down.
  • Embed privacy-by-design into Orion's development lifecycle, partnering with Engineering to resolve data-flow and retention questions before they become launch blockers.
  • Lead and respond to data subject rights requests (DSARs) in coordination with Engineering and Customer Success.
  • Build and maintain the privacy program's core artifacts - records of processing, DPIA templates, and breach-response playbooks - using AI-assisted workflows so the program scales without adding headcount.

Requirements

  • 4+ years of privacy and data-protection legal experience, with hands-on work applying GDPR and US state privacy laws to a technology product.
  • Familiarity with cross-border transfer mechanisms (SCCs, transfer impact assessments, adequacy analysis).
